What Sets a Bio STP Apart?

A Bio Sewage Treatment Plant operates with eco-friendly process. Rather than using loads of harmful chemicals inside the tank to clean the sludge at the bottom of the tank, it works by employing naturally active bacteria to digest the waste in sewage. The microbes "munch on" the organic waste, producing clean, safe water that can be recycled.

How Does It Actually Work?


·       Screening – Large items (such as plastics or detritus) are sorted out.

·       Primary Settling – Dense waste settles at the bottom, isolating from liquid.

·       Biological Magic – Microorganisms come in and digest organic waste.

·       Disinfection – The water is treated so it's safe to reuse or discharge.

Thus effluent is clean, pure and completely effective for long run than other systems
